What is the New Zealand Electrical Worker Registration Application?
The New Zealand Electrical Worker Registration Application is a critical form for individuals seeking official registration and licensing as electrical workers in New Zealand. This application serves the purpose of regulating the electrical work sector, ensuring that practitioners meet the necessary standards and competencies established by the Electrical Workers Registration Board (EWRB). Completing this form is the first step to obtaining the legal right to work as an accredited electrical professional in the country.

Eligibility Criteria for the New Zealand Electrical Worker Registration Application
To qualify for the New Zealand Electrical Worker Registration Application, applicants must meet specific eligibility criteria. These criteria include:
-
Minimum age requirement, typically 18 years or older.
-
Residency status, which typically requires individuals to be residents of New Zealand.
-
Completion of relevant training programs related to electrical work.
-
Possession of necessary certifications and competencies.
-
Experience in the field, which can be a prerequisite for advanced licensing levels.
Required Documents and Supporting Materials
Applicants must prepare several documents to successfully complete the New Zealand Electrical Worker Registration Application. Required materials typically include:
-
Personal identification, such as a driver’s license or passport.
-
Documentation of completed safety training courses.
-
Evidence of participation in competency programs.
-
Details regarding payment methods for applicable fees.

Who is eligible to apply for the New Zealand Electrical Worker Registration?
Individuals seeking to register as electrical workers and acquire a valid professional license are eligible to apply, provided they meet the competency standards set by EWRB.
What are the typical processing times for the registration application?
While processing times may vary, applicants can generally expect a response from the Electrical Workers Registration Board within 4-6 weeks after submission.
What supporting documents are required for this application?
Applicants must provide identification documents, proof of safety training completion, and details regarding their competency program to support their application.
